Foam Concentrate Injection Hose

Connect a hose from the foam pump inject port to the inlet of the check
valve injector fitting. (See Figure 3-20: “Injection and Bypass Hose Connec-
tions.”)

Figure 3-20: Injection and Bypass Hose Connections

The hose and fittings from the INJECT port to the check valve injector fitting
should have a minimum 1/2” (13 mm) inside diameter and be rated at 500
PSI (34 BAR) working pressure (Aeroquip 2580-10 or equal).

Bypass Hose Connection

A bypass port is provided on the discharge side of the ADT, or a 1/4 turn
bypass valve is mounted on the discharge of the foam pump when the ADT
option is not installed. (See Figure 3-21: “Bypass Valve Assembly,” on page
73.)

The bypass handle must be accessible by the pump operator during normal
operations. (See Figure 3-20: “Injection and Bypass Hose Connections.”)

The bypass is a 3-way directional valve. Determine which port is the
INJECT port and which port is the BYPASS. (See Figure 3-21: “Bypass
Valve Assembly,” on page 73.)

Bypass hose connections are 1/2” (13mm). Hose fittings compatible with all
foam concentrates must be provided. The hose from the BYPASS port is
plumbed to the atmosphere and should not receive HIGH pressure.
